Vehicle Type:
Lightweight, mid-engined, rear-wheel drive sports car.
Segment:
Pure sports car, track-day focus.
Key Competitors Era:
Porsche Boxster, BMW Z3, Honda S2000, Toyota MR2 (W20/W30).
Philosophy:
Minimalist, driver-focused, pure driving experience, exceptional handling and feedback.
Chassis Design:
Revolutionary extruded and bonded aluminium honeycomb chassis tub, offering immense rigidity and low weight.

Engine Type:
Rover K-Series, Naturally Aspirated Inline-4
Engine Code Examples:
K8 (1.8L DOHC 16-valve VVC)
Displacement:
1.8 Liters (1796 cc)
Horsepower Range:
118 hp (standard), 145 hp (VVC)
Torque Range:
116 lb-ft (standard), 122 lb-ft (VVC)
Fuel Delivery:
Electronic Fuel Injection (EFI)
Fuel Type:
Unleaded Gasoline (95 RON / 91 AKI recommended)
ECU Type:
Lotus-tuned MEMS (Multi-point Engine Management System)
Diagnostic Ports:
OBD-II compliant, allowing for engine fault code retrieval with compatible scan tools.
Cooling System Type:
Pressurised liquid cooling system
Oil Capacity Liters:
4.5 Liters (with filter)
Oil Specification:
API SJ/SL, ACEA A3/B3 or higher, SAE 5W-30 or 10W-40 (depending on climate)
Oil Change Interval Miles:
Every 9,000 miles or 12 months, whichever comes first.
Major Service Interval Miles:
Every 18,000 miles or 24 months, including inspection of suspension, brakes, and engine components.
Timing Belt Replacement Miles:
Every 60,000 miles or 5 years (for Rover K-Series engines fitted with a timing belt - *Note: Some K-Series use a chain, but early Elise typically used belt-driven cams. Manual will confirm specific engine variant.*)
Coolant Type:
Ethylene Glycol based antifreeze/coolant, typically pink or blue, mix 50/50 with distilled water.
Brake Fluid Type:
DOT 4 (or DOT 4 LV for improved cold weather performance)
Clutch Fluid Type:
DOT 4 (shared with brake system)
Coolant Capacity:
Approximately 6.5 Liters
Engine Head Gasket:
The K-Series engine, particularly early versions, was known for potential head gasket failure. The manual will detail correct installation and torque procedures to mitigate this.
Chassis Corrosion:
While the aluminium chassis is resistant to rust, improper repair or impact damage can lead to corrosion at bonded joints. Manual provides repair guidelines.
Vvc Mechanism:
The Variable Valve Control (VVC) system on higher-performance variants can be complex. The manual offers troubleshooting for its operation.
Lotus Philosophy:
Founded by Colin Chapman, emphasizing lightweight construction, aerodynamic efficiency, and superior handling ('Grace, Pace, Space').
Elise Concept:
Reimagining the spirit of the original Lotus Elan for the modern era, focusing on pure driving pleasure and advanced materials.
Series 1 Introduction:
Launched in 1996 as a successor to the Lotus Elan M100 and a spiritual descendant of the original Elan.
Manufacturing Location:
Hethel, Norfolk, England
